The best recent example of cancel culture is that of Goya Foods CEO Robert Unanue. On Thursday, Unanue — an Hispanic man — ran afoul of the cancel culture mob by saying: “We’re all truly blessed — to have a leader like President Trump, who is a builder.”

That’s all it took and the mob, which includes Democrat politicians, attacked and called for Goya Foods to be boycotted. Julian Castro, the Secretary of Housing and Urban Development under Barack Obama and one of the failed Democrat presidential candidates, urged the mob on with a tweet.

“Goya Foods has been a staple of so many Latino households for generations. Now, their CEO, Bob Unanue, is praising a president who villainizes and maliciously attacks Latinos for political gain. Americans should think twice before buying their products. #Goyaway.”

AOC quickly jumped on the destroy-Goya bandwagon by tweeting, “Oh, look, it’s the sound of me Googling ‘how to make your own adobo,’” a Spanish sauce and a popular Goya product. The New York congresswoman then shared a friend’s recipe for adobo.

So, according to AOC, it’s just fine to attempt to destroy a generations-old, immigrant-founded, Hispanic-owned business if the CEO makes a public comment praising President Trump.

Thus far, despite tremendous pressure, Unanue has steadfastly refused to apologize for his comments in praise of the president. Unanue bluntly told Fox News, “I’m not apologizing,” and he called the boycott and pressure from the Left “suppression of speech.”
